Triage rotation owns weekly grouping review. If symbolication lags, check worker pool health first; most stalls are stale symbol uploads. New builds must register symbols before release cut. Dashboards are read-only for non-rotation members; request access through the pipeline lead. For pipeline outages or access issues during the sync window, contact the pipeline owner directly.

escalation mailbox, kadup-fajof: ulador@qirvanlabs.corp

// WEBHOOK_RETRY_CAP — Pipsqueak delivery service.
// We retry five times with jittered backoff, then park the
// event in the dead-letter tray. So when a customer says
// "it never arrived," check the tray first before escalating.
// Replays are manual on purpose. The build enforcing this
// cap carries the token below.

trace token, fafog-kageg: htk4_98e6

Internal Memo — Headcount Plan for Next Year

To the finance team: next year's headcount plan holds total staffing flat across Norwick Instruments, with reallocation rather than net growth. Twelve roles move from the Pellman assembly line to the new calibration lab, and four administrative positions will not be backfilled. Budget holders should submit revised salary forecasts by the end of the month so consolidation can begin on schedule. The confidential note below explains the reasoning behind these allocations.

board note of baweg-bawig: Project Tamath slips by six weeks because of the audit delay.